Bruce Skaug is an Idaho state representative known for his advocacy of the death penalty, particularly the use of the firing squad as a method of execution. He has sponsored legislation aimed at restoring the firing squad as a backup option to lethal injection, citing concerns over the reliability and humanity of lethal injection procedures. Skaug's efforts come amidst heightened discussions surrounding capital punishment in Idaho, especially in relation to high-profile cases such as that of Bryan Kohberger, who faces charges for the murder of four University of Idaho students.
